On Tue, Aug 30, 2005 at 08:30:03AM +0800, Syan Tan wrote:
> also , what if clients are allowed to be non-real time , or using a
> store-and-forward to gnotary, where there is an allowable time lapse?
>
> patient X isn't explained certain risks, but as soon as they leave, the
> helpful
> emr pops up a reminder to explain risks, and asks
>
> whether to auto-record the risks have been explained, and the doc, presses the
> yes button quickly, and moves to the next patient,
>
> and the delay of 2 minutes is the difference between a document with and
> without risks explained.
That doesn't make any difference whatsoever.
GNotary is about being able to prove the *integrity* of a
document not the truthfulness of the content.
